Heritage Elementary School is a Kindergarten-5th Grade Public School located in Marion, OH within the River Valley Local District. It has 488 students in grades Kindergarten-5th Grade with a student-teacher ratio of 20 to 1. Heritage Elementary School spends $9,075 per student.
